This paper presents a detailed study on fatigue strength of welded joints made of two titanium alloys, grade 2 and grade 5, and welded by laser or hybrid process. Fatigue strength curves obtained for each alloy and each welding technique are compared in terms of safety factors with fatigue design curves of welded joints provided by standards. Material and welding process effects on fatigue strength are discussed; the influence of the weld seam geometry is assessed by evaluating the fatigue strength reduction factor. This parameter is computed by using the Volumetric Method of the Notch Fracture Mechanics and defined as the ratio of the effective stress and the gross stress. Effective stress is defined on the weld toe stress distribution by the minimum of relative stress gradient method. Distribution of opening stress at weld toe is analysed also with the finite element analysis.
